  • What is the discrepancy theory in computer science?

    Discrepancy theory is the study of irregularities of distributions.
    A typical question is: given a “complicated” distribution, find a “simple” one that approximates it well.
    As it turns out, many questions in complexity theory can be reduced to problems of that type.Mar 29, 2001.

  • What is the discrepancy theory in math?

    In mathematics, discrepancy theory describes the deviation of a situation from the state one would like it to be in.
    It is also called the theory of irregularities of distribution..
